Factors Affecting Cost
- Tree Size: Larger trees generally cost more to remove due to the increased labor and equipment required.
- Location: Trees located near structures or power lines may require special equipment and precautions, increasing the cost.
- Accessibility: Easily accessible trees are less expensive to remove than those in hard-to-reach areas.
- Health of Tree: Diseased or dead trees can be more hazardous to remove, potentially raising the cost.
- Stump Removal: Whether or not you choose to remove the stump can significantly affect the total cost.
- Disposal Fees: The cost of disposing of the tree debris can vary based on local regulations and landfill fees.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Oceanside, CA) |
---|---|
Small Tree Removal (Under 15 ft) | $150 - $300 |
Medium Tree Removal (15-30 ft) | $300 - $600 |
Large Tree Removal (Over 30 ft) | $600 - $1,200 |
Stump Grinding | $100 - $200 |
Stump Removal | $200 - $400 |
Debris Disposal | $50 - $150 |
